A cerebral vascular accident, or CVA, is an interruption of blood flow to the brain. Without adequate blood flow, brain cells die. A stroke occurs when an artery ruptures or becomes blocked inside or outside the brain. The symptoms vary depending on the cause, location, and extent of brain damage. Some common symptoms include confusion and dizziness. It can also affect one or both sides of the body. If you suspect that someone is having a stroke, call 911 immediately. Do not drive to the hospital. An ambulance will take you to the emergency room where the stroke team will evaluate your condition. Depending on the severity of the stroke, your doctor may prescribe medicine or perform surgery to remove the clot. Once you’re stable and fully recovered, your doctor may recommend a rehabilitation plan to assist you with the recovery process.

The risk of stroke is greater for people with high blood pressure. Lowering blood pressure can prevent a subsequent stroke. Medications and healthy lifestyle changes can help lower your risk. A healthy diet with low sodium and fatty acids, as well as a regular exercise routine, can reduce your risk. You should also take blood-thinning medications to help prevent clots. These medicines must be taken regularly, and you may even be prescribed over-the-counter antiplatelets.
